How to Travel from Chinggis Khaan International Airport to Ulaanbaatar

Arriving at Chinggis Khaan International Airport can be both exciting and overwhelming, especially if it's your first visit to Mongolia. Located about 52 kilometers southwest of Ulaanbaatar, the airport serves as the primary gateway to Mongolia’s vibrant capital. In this guide, we’ll walk you through the various transportation options available to get you from the airport to Ulaanbaatar, helping you choose the best one for your needs. Traveling from Chinggis Khaan International Airport to Ulaanbaatar is relatively straightforward, with multiple transportation options catering to different budgets and preferences. Whether you opt for the convenience of a taxi, the economy of a public bus, or the flexibility of a car rental, you’ll find a suitable way to kickstart your Mongolian adventure. Before you travel, make sure to check the latest information regarding transportation schedules and costs, as these can change. Safe travels, and enjoy your time in Ulaanbaatar!

1. Taxi Services

One of the most convenient ways to travel from Chinggis Khaan International Airport to Ulaanbaatar is by taxi. Here’s what you need to know: Availability: Taxis are readily available outside the airport terminal. As soon as you exit the arrivals area, you’ll spot a line of taxis waiting to take passengers to the city. Cost: A taxi ride to Ulaanbaatar typically costs between 70,000 to 100,000 MNT (Mongolian Tugrik), which is approximately $25 to $35 USD. Prices can vary based on traffic and time of day. Travel Time: The journey usually takes around 1 to 1.5 hours, depending on traffic conditions. During peak hours, the travel time might be longer due to congestion in the city. Tips: It’s advisable to agree on a fare with the driver before starting your trip to avoid any misunderstandings. Ensure the taxi has a working meter or that you agree on a set price before departing. Carry some cash in local currency as not all taxis accept credit cards.

2. Airport Shuttle Bus

For a more budget-friendly option, consider taking the airport shuttle bus: Service: The airport offers a shuttle bus service that operates between Chinggis Khaan International Airport and central Ulaanbaatar. Cost: The fare is around 10,000 MNT (about $3.50 USD) per person. Travel Time: The shuttle bus journey can take up to 2 hours, factoring in traffic and multiple stops along the route. Schedule: The shuttle buses run on a fixed schedule, typically aligning with flight arrival times. It’s best to check the schedule in advance on the airport’s official website. Tips: Arrive at the bus stop early to secure a seat, especially during peak travel times. Keep an eye on your belongings, as buses can get crowded.

3. Public Bus

For the adventurous traveler, the public bus is the cheapest way to get to Ulaanbaatar: Service: Public buses connect the airport with various parts of Ulaanbaatar. Cost: A ticket costs around 500 MNT (approximately $0.18 USD), making it the most economical option. Travel Time: The trip can take anywhere from 1.5 to 2.5 hours, depending on traffic and the bus route. Tips: Buses can be crowded, and space for luggage is limited. It’s a good idea to have a local SIM card or internet access to track your route on a map. Be prepared for a more rugged travel experience compared to taxis or shuttle buses.

4. Car Rentals

If you prefer the flexibility of driving yourself, renting a car is a great option: Availability: Several car rental companies operate at Chinggis Khaan International Airport. You can book in advance online or rent directly at the airport. Cost: Daily rental rates range from $40 to $100 USD, depending on the type of vehicle and rental duration. Travel Time: The drive to Ulaanbaatar takes about 1 to 1.5 hours, but having a car allows you to explore the area at your own pace. Tips: Familiarize yourself with Mongolian traffic rules and road conditions before setting out. Ensure your rental agreement includes insurance. Keep in mind that parking in Ulaanbaatar can be challenging, especially in busy areas.

5. Ride-Hailing Apps

Modern technology has made travel easier, and Mongolia is no exception. Ride-hailing apps like UBCab and iTaxi are popular in Ulaanbaatar: Availability: These apps can be used to book a ride from the airport to the city center. Cost: Fares are comparable to traditional taxis, often ranging from 70,000 to 100,000 MNT ($25 to $35 USD). Travel Time: Expect the journey to take 1 to 1.5 hours, subject to traffic. Tips: Download the app and set up your account before arriving at the airport. Check for available discounts or promo codes within the app.

6. Hotel Transfers

Many hotels in Ulaanbaatar offer airport transfer services for their guests: Service: This is a convenient option if you’ve booked accommodation in advance. Hotels usually provide private cars or shuttle services. Cost: Prices vary widely, often included in the room rate or charged separately. Expect to pay between $30 to $50 USD. Travel Time: Similar to taxis, the journey takes around 1 to 1.5 hours. Tips: Confirm the transfer details with your hotel ahead of your arrival. Look for a driver holding a sign with your name in the arrivals hall.
